What Does It Mean to Truly Know Yourself?
Many people spend years pursuing goals they believe will make them happy. However, they often discover that achievement alone does not provide lasting satisfaction. Real growth begins when you pause and honestly examine your thoughts, emotions, experiences, and motivations.
Knowing yourself means understanding:
- Your core values and principles
- The experiences that shaped your perspective
- Your natural strengths and talents
- Habits that support or limit growth
- The purpose that motivates your decisions
Instead of following someone else’s definition of success, self-awareness allows you to build a life aligned with what genuinely matters.
Self-Awareness Creates Better Decisions
Every decision reflects personal beliefs. When those beliefs remain unexplored, choices often become reactive rather than intentional. Greater self-awareness helps people recognize unhealthy patterns, overcome fear, and make confident decisions that support long-term happiness.
As a result, challenges become opportunities for learning instead of reasons to stop moving forward.
Why Personal Transformation Begins from Within
Many people attempt to change their careers, relationships, or environments before addressing their mindset. Unfortunately, external changes rarely create permanent results without internal growth.
Personal transformation begins by changing how you think before changing what you do. Once your perspective shifts, your actions naturally follow.
Several internal changes often happen first:
- Increased emotional resilience
- Greater confidence during uncertainty
- Improved communication with others
- Stronger sense of purpose
- Healthier daily habits
These changes gradually influence every area of life, creating progress that feels authentic rather than forced.
The Role of Travel in Discovering Your Authentic Self
Travel often removes familiar routines and places people in situations that require adaptability. Without daily distractions, individuals have more opportunities to reflect on their priorities and beliefs.
Visiting new cultures encourages curiosity instead of judgment. Meeting different people broadens perspective while revealing how similar human experiences truly are.
Nature, especially remote landscapes, provides another powerful setting for reflection. Quiet moments away from technology allow deeper thinking and emotional clarity that can be difficult to experience during busy schedules.
Many travelers describe returning home with renewed confidence because they better understand themselves after stepping beyond their comfort zones.

Practical Habits That Support Lasting Growth
Transformation rarely happens overnight. Instead, consistent habits gradually reshape perspective and behavior.
Consider adding these practices into daily life:
Reflect Through Journaling
Writing thoughts on paper helps identify recurring emotions, fears, and aspirations. Even ten minutes each day can reveal valuable patterns.
Spend Time in Nature
Natural environments reduce mental clutter while encouraging mindfulness and creativity. Regular walks, hiking, or quiet observation often improve emotional balance.
Welcome Constructive Discomfort
Growth usually exists outside familiar routines. Trying new experiences develops confidence while expanding perspective.
Practice Mindful Decision-Making
Before making important choices, ask whether each decision aligns with your personal values instead of temporary emotions.
These simple habits strengthen awareness while supporting continuous personal development.
Overcoming Common Obstacles Along the Journey
Although personal growth sounds inspiring, it is rarely easy. Many people encounter fear, self-doubt, comparison, or uncertainty along the way.
Fortunately, these obstacles are normal rather than permanent.
Helpful strategies include:
- Accept progress instead of perfection.
- Celebrate small improvements consistently.
- Seek supportive communities and mentors.
- Learn from mistakes without harsh self-judgment.
- Stay patient during periods of slow progress.
Every challenge becomes another opportunity to build resilience and wisdom.
Over time, even difficult experiences contribute valuable lessons that shape stronger character and greater confidence.
